He/she represents the PUI to the authorities, humanitarian organizations and donors in the health sector.
TASKS AND DUTIES
Context Analysis / Strategy / Development: Participates in the development of the operational health strategy and contributes to the development of new relevant health interventions within the mission based on the identified health needs of the country and in accordance with the policy and concept of health interventions developed by the PUI. In coordination with the health team, he/she carries out epidemiological monitoring in the country and analyzes strengths and weaknesses from a public health perspective.
Ensuring the appropriate quality of programs: Provides technical support in his area of expertise to program teams, in particular, to multi-sectoral project managers, and ensures the quality and effectiveness of the mission's health care programs.
Personnel Management / Training: Provides technical support to project teams, including healthcare teams. Provides support to multisectoral project managers in the selection of technical personnel for health care. Working with the Chief of Mission and/or Deputy Chief of Mission for Programs and the Headquarters Health Technical Advisor, he/she identifies key str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and gaps in the health department. He/she supervises the content of health care trainings and the quality of health care activities based on identified needs.
Logistics and Administration: Ensures compliance with logistics and administrative procedures by the teams under his/her direction and informs logistics and administration departments of any relevant changes.
Security: Promotes mission security and shares all security related information,with your immediate supervisor and/or mission security chief. If necessary, he/she participates in the selection of referral options for the provision of medical care to foreigners working in the mission.
